Binghamton University Stats
Enrollment Deposit
How much is Binghamton's enrollment deposit?
Binghamton University requires a deposit of $350 to confirm your enrollment.

Student Population
Binghamton University educates a diverse community of 20,307 students, with 15,958 pursuing undergraduate degrees and 4,349 engaged in advanced graduate studies.

Admissions
The admission process at Binghamton University has a 38% acceptance rate. The cost to apply is $50. Binghamton University has test required that focus on each student's unique potential. The average SAT score is 1410 and the average ACT score is 32.

Cost
Binghamton University makes education accessible, offering an average net price of $18,860 with 78% of students receiving financial assistance including 27% benefiting from Pell Grants.
